What Are Three Spirit Drinks?

Three Spirit is a UK-based company founded by Dash Lilley, Tatiana Mercer, and Meera Gournay in 2018. Their mission is to create non-alcoholic spirits that replicate the taste, mouthfeel, and cocktail mixing potential of traditional liquors while providing functional benefits through plant-based ingredients.

Each Three Spirit elixir contains a carefully crafted blend of herbs, adaptogens, and nootropics selected for their flavor profiles and effects on the mind and body. The brand works with plant scientists, bartenders, and herbalists to develop their unique formulas.

The resulting drinks are designed to be sipped like a spirit or mixed into non-alcoholic cocktails. With Three Spirit, you can enjoy the social and sensory experience of drinking without the negative impacts of alcohol.

Livener

Key Ingredients: Guayusa, Green Tea, Schisandra Berry, Siberian Ginseng, Watermelon, Guava Leaf, Red Raspberry, Angelica Root, Ginger, Lemon, Rosemary

Vibe: Energetic, Euphoric, Creative

Tasting Notes: Livener has a vibrant, juicy aroma with notes of watermelon and guava. On the palate, it is bright and fruity with a subtle sweetness balanced by a spicy ginger kick. The finish is dry and slightly herbaceous, with a pleasant tingling sensation from the Sichuan peppercorn.

Mixology: Livener is delicious sipped over ice, but it also plays well in cocktails. Try it in a Livener & Tonic with a squeeze of lime, or mix it with ginger beer and a dash of bitters for a zingy Livener Mule.

The Science: Livener‘s key functional ingredients are natural sources of caffeine, including guayusa and green tea, which provide a clean, sustained energy boost without the jitters. Schisandra, an adaptogenic berry, helps the body cope with stress, while Siberian ginseng supports mental alertness and physical stamina.

Social Elixir

Key Ingredients: Lion‘s Mane Mushroom, Yerba Mate, Damiana, Passion Flower, Cacao, Green Tea, Molasses, Caraway Seed, Vanilla, Coconut Vinegar

Vibe: Mood-Boosting, Empathetic, Confident

Tasting Notes: Social Elixir is rich and bittersweet, with an earthy undertone from the Lion‘s Mane mushroom. Cacao and vanilla lend a chocolatey warmth, while molasses adds a malty depth. Yerba mate and green tea provide a subtle caffeinated lift. The finish is lightly spiced with caraway and a hint of coconut.

Mixology: Social Elixir‘s smooth, full-bodied flavor makes it a great swap for dark spirits like whiskey, rum, or aged tequila. It shines in a Social Old Fashioned with a touch of agave syrup and orange bitters, or try it in a Social Espresso Martini shaken with espresso and maple syrup.

The Science: Lion‘s Mane, a nootropic mushroom, has been shown to support cognitive function, memory, and creativity. Damiana, a wild shrub native to Mexico, has long been used as a natural mood elevator and may help alleviate social anxiety. Yerba mate provides a more balanced energy boost than coffee, thanks to its unique combination of caffeine and theobromine.

Nightcap

Key Ingredients: Valerian Root, Ashwagandha, Lemon Balm, Hops, Turmeric, Maple Syrup, Hazelnut, Vanilla, Cinnamon, Black Pepper

Vibe: Calming, Restorative, Grounding

Tasting Notes: Nightcap has a warm, nutty aroma with hints of maple and vanilla. On the sip, it is silky and slightly sweet, with a comforting spiced flavor reminiscent of chai or spiced rum. The hops add an earthy bitterness that balances the sweetness. Valerian root and lemon balm lend a subtle herbal note to the finish.

Mixology: With its smooth, spice-forward flavor, Nightcap can be sipped neat or over ice as a nightcap. It also makes a lovely hot toddy – simply mix with hot water, honey, and lemon and garnish with a cinnamon stick. For a creamy nightcap, try it mixed with warm oat milk and a sprinkle of nutmeg.

The Science: Valerian root and lemon balm have been used for centuries as natural sleep aids, thanks to their calming properties. Studies show that they can reduce anxiety and improve sleep quality without causing drowsiness the next day. Ashwagandha, an adaptogenic herb, has been clinically proven to lower cortisol levels and promote relaxation, while turmeric has anti-inflammatory benefits.
